Key Duties

  • Provide actuarial pricing support to various underwriting departments under moderate supervision.
  • Support all lines of insurance written from the European offices and through Lloyd’s. Lines of business include property, general casualty, D&O, E&O, medical malpractice, marine and onshore construction.
  • Research and update various pricing parameters used within their pricing models such as increased limits factors, loss trend factors, underlying loss costs per unit of exposure, etc.

Qualifications

  • Bachelor’s degree in mathematics, statistics or related field.
  • Up to 3 years of experience as a General Insurance actuary, preferably London Market Pricing insurance or reinsurance.
  • Proficient with Excel.
  • Experience using Visual Basic for Applications (VBA), Rulebook, SAS and Python would be beneficial.
